The Relationship Banker I serves as the frontline of our branch, ensuring accurate and timely processing of teller and cash vault transactions. This role is dedicated to providing exceptional customer service while strictly adhering to bank policies, maintaining essential controls, and mitigating risk. Beyond transactional accuracy, you will play a key part in helping customers achieve their financial goals through the sales and servicing of bank products and services.
You will work closely with the branch team to drive collective success, balancing individual performance metrics with team scorecard goals. Your day-to-day involves handling customer inquiries, managing cash drawers and vaults, and identifying opportunities to offer appropriate products to both new and existing clients. By demonstrating the Bank's "Right by You" quality standards, you will contribute to a superior level of customer service and operational excellence.

Fidelity Bank, a full-service financial institution based in Atlanta, Georgia, provides a range of banking solutions through its ownership by Fidelity Southern Corporation (NASDAQ: LION), a bank holding company with $3.8 billion in assets and over 1,500 employees. The bank operates 65 retail branches across Georgia and Northern/Central Florida, emphasizing customer service guided by the Golden Rule. Its services include mortgage lending, wealth management, SBA loans, commercial banking, indirect automobile financing, and construction lending. Fidelity Bank’s in-house processing capabilities support its position as a top mortgage lender in Georgia and the broader Southeast and Mid-Atlantic regions. Committed to equitable practices, the bank adheres to equal opportunity employment principles and complies with federal and state non-discrimination laws. As a member of the FDIC and an Equal Housing Lender, Fidelity Bank serves communities through locally focused financial expertise.
